About The Brewery

Fuji Sake Brewery (冨士酒造)

Founded in 1778 in Tsuruoka, Yamagata Prefecture, Fuji Sake Brewery is a historic house with over 240 years of heritage. Its flagship brand, "Eiko Fuji," has gained immense popularity for its commitment to the Muroka Nama Genshu (unfiltered, unpasteurized, and undiluted) style. This approach preserves the sake's vibrant, floral aromas and bold Umami in its purest form. Known for experimenting with diverse yeasts and rare rice varieties, the brewery creates profiles that are remarkably juicy, fresh, and fruit-forward. With modern, striking label designs that complement their artisanal craftsmanship, Fuji Sake Brewery stands as a leader in the contemporary trend of highly aromatic and expressive premium sake.
